      <title>Popocatepetl Volcano Erupts: A Plume Of Ash And Glowing Rock, Mexican Officals Do Not Order Evacuation</title>
      <link>http://au.ibtimes.com/articles/331160/20120421/popocatepetl-volcano-erupts-mexican-officals-order-evacuation.htm</link>
      <description>Popocatepetl volcano shot a heavy plume of ash into the sky, just southeast of Mexico's capital city, as it spewed glowing rock and magma from its crater around dawn on Friday.</description>

      <title>Santiago Xalitzintla Journal: In Mexico, a Volcano Rumbles, but Few Flinch</title>
      <link>http://www.nytimes.com/2012/04/20/world/americas/in-mexico-a-volcano-rumbles-but-few-flinch.html?partner=rss&amp;emc=rss</link>
      <description>The Popocatépetl volcano spewed a cloud of ash again this week, but lifelong residents nearby who see it as a protector have no plans to evacuate.</description>
